A Typeface Forged in Digital Culture

At its core, Hacker School is a unique experiment in techno and web security-inspired design. It draws inspiration from the aesthetics of code, cyberpunk visuals, and the raw energy of hacker culture. However, unlike many display fonts that sacrifice usability for style, this typeface strikes a delicate balance. It combines organic details with strong geometric shapes, creating a look that feels both human and high-tech. The letterforms feature bent corners and distinctive contours that mimic the imagery of contemporary digital environments. Mastering the Pairing: Integrating Hacker School into Your Workflow

To get the most out of this experimental font, you need to think about contrast. Because Hacker School has such a strong personality, it pairs best with clean, neutral typefaces for body copy. This is a fundamental rule of font pairing.

The Tech-Forward Look:
Pair Hacker School with a clean sans-serif font like Roboto, Open Sans, or Helvetica. This combination allows the display font to shine as the headline while the sans-serif keeps the body text legible and professional. This is a go-to strategy for web design and app interfaces.

The Contrast Approach:
For a more editorial or artistic vibe, try pairing it with a classic serif font. The juxtaposition of the futuristic, geometric display font against a traditional, elegant serif creates a sophisticated tension that works well for magazine layouts or upscale tech branding.

Before finalizing your design, always test the font in context. Check the kerning (the space between letters) and ensure the unique "bent corners" of the letters don't clash with adjacent characters in your specific copy. While the font is designed for impact, ensuring readability at various sizes is key—especially for headers that might appear on mobile screens.
